Last Hope by Duane Boehm
Last Hope is the highly anticipated third book in the Gideon Johann Western series. It joins #1 bestseller novels on Amazon.com in Western Classics, Last Stand and Last Chance.

Love, second chances, new beginnings, and dispensing justice – all set in the town of Last Stand, Colorado in 1880.

Sheriff Gideon Johann has left the past behind and is enjoying his new life with his childhood sweetheart Abby. He crosses paths with a down on his luck buddy from the war and takes on the challenge of aiding Finnie in the same way that his friends did for him. In the midst of helping Finnie, a whore is murdered in Last Stand and the sheriff realizes that he has a conspiracy to solve. Gideon has his hands full as he tries to keep Finnie on the straight and narrow, solve a crime that has implications for the whole town, and help his lifelong friend, Ethan, get back on his feet.

Mary, the former whore, is now the successful proprietor of the Last Stand Last Chance Saloon. She finds her life turned upside down when Gideon recruits her in his quest to get the charming little Irishman Finnie back on his feet.

Gideon’s daughter, Joann, comes for a visit from the Wyoming Territory. Her brief romance with Gideon’s friend, Zack, has ended and the two young adults find their new relationship angst-filled and a comical calamity.
